Designing with CPLDs

Xilinx CPLDs Provide Maximum Design Benefits

Understanding the features and benefits of using CPLDs can help enable ease of design, lower development costs, and speed products to market.

CPLD Benefits at a Glance:

  • Ease of design
  • Lower development costs
  • More product revenue for your money
  • Reduced board area
  • Increased system reliability
  • Speed your product time to market

Get started now by following these four easy steps:

Step 1: Choosing a CPLD

In choosing the CPLD that is right for a design, you need to make the following determinations (the priority of each will vary according to your design):

Density and I/O

  • You can find the size of Xilinx CPLD required (logic density and I/O) for your design by submitting your design to the free downloadable ISE™ WebPACK™ software

Performance

  • Xilinx CPLDs come in a variety of speed grades so that you only pay for the performance you need. Use ISE WebPACK to determine the speed grade you need to meet your system timing requirements.

Voltage and Power

  • Different Xilinx CPLD families have different voltage (supply and I/O) and power (standby and dynamic) requirements.

Packaging

  • Xilinx CPLDs come in a range of packages, from inexpensive QFP packages to ultra small chip-scale pages, to high-I/O-count BGA packages.

Xilinx CPLD Families

  • CoolRunner™ Series
    The CoolRunner Series of Xilinx CPLDs feature the lowest-power, highest-performance devices in the industry. These CPLDs deliver advanced features to support system-level designs such as I/O banking, sophisticated clock control, and superb design security.
      
  • XC9500 Series
    Offered in 5.0V (XC9500 family), 3.3V (XC9500XL family), and 2.5V (XC9500XV family) versions, these low-cost CPLD families provide the high performance, expansive feature set, and flexibility demanded by today's cutting-edge system design.

Step 2: Choosing a Software Package

CPLD and Simple FGPA Designs

To implement basic CPLD or FPGA designs, you will need our free ISE WebPACK software tool.

Any CPLD/ FPGA Designs

Beyond ISE WebPACK software tools, Xilinx offers a variety of software packages to meet various design requirements. Click here to determine the software package that best fits your designing needs.

Step 3: Implementing a Design

After selecting a CPLD device and downloading the necessary software, implementing the design is next. Implementation includes:

  • Design entry
  • Programming and testing the prototype
  • Documentation

Each of the CPLD product pages contain links to supporting application notes, reference designs, development boards, configuration tools, and other useful information to help complete designs quickly and easily.

Step 4: Purchasing CPLDs

There are several ways to purchase Xilinx solutions:

Each outlet offers silicon, software, programming hardware and more. The Xilinx sales offices and customer support center make sure that the use of Xilinx CPLDs is a simple and satisfying experience.

 
Jobs Events Webcasts News Investors Feedback Legal Sitemap
© 1994-2008 Xilinx, Inc. All Rights Reserved.